You’ll develop a creative approach to business that leads to true innovation in the business world and helps you to become an outstanding business leader.Approaching business problems creatively, you’ll develop a skill set for tackling complex issues based on a deep understanding of client needs, collaborative working, cross-disciplinary thinking, personal reflection and rapid prototyping of new ideas.Visiting guest speakers with a range of specialisms will enhance your knowledge.You’ll be assessed through presentations, independent projects, essays and portfolio review, business cases and business venture proposalsThrough design thinking and practical exercises that build on theory, you’ll enhance your management and leadership capabilities and develop an entrepreneurial mindset. You’ll benefit from the expertise of committed and research-active teaching staff with excellent academic and business experience.At the master’s stage, you will complete a dissertation.
